Python KeyError Exceptions and How to Handle Them
Rich Bibby
5 Lessons
10m
basics
python
Pythonβs KeyError exception is a common exception encountered by beginners. Knowing why a KeyError can be raised and some solutions to prevent it from stopping your program are essential steps to improving as a Python programmer.
By the end of this course, youβll know:
- What a Python
KeyErrorusually means - Where else you might see a
KeyErrorin the standard library - How to handle a
KeyErrorwhen you see it - When to raise a Python
KeyErrorin your code
Python KeyError Exceptions and How to Handle Them
5 Lessons 10m
About Rich Bibby
Rich is an avid Pythonista and a video instructor at Real Python. He is also a Network Engineer using Python to automate the management of a large network infrastructure. He lives in Dubai, UAE, with his wife and daughter plus a Miniature Schnauzer.
Β» More about Rich




Chasp on Nov. 26, 2019
Succinct and helpful. Really like Richβs style of explanation. Learned something new!